Family disturbance with possible vehicle confinement near Gaylord Pkwy, Frisco TX

According to the dispatch call, a possible family disturbance near Gaylord Parkway and Preston Road involving a male and female in a white Infiniti SUV. The male may be preventing the female from exiting the vehicle. Both subjects remain inside the vehicle as officers respond.
